At a Glance
- Tasks: Drive projects in software supply chain security and collaborate across teams.
- Company: Bloomberg empowers over 9,000 engineers with tools for high-quality code.
- Benefits: Work in a dynamic environment with opportunities for remote work and diverse corporate perks.
- Why this job: Be at the forefront of securing software supply chains and influence industry standards.
- Qualifications: Experience in Python or Go and knowledge of the software development lifecycle required.
- Other info: Bloomberg values diversity and is committed to an inclusive workplace.
The predicted salary is between 43200 - 72000 £ per year.
In Bloomberg, the Developer Experience (DevX) group provides services and tooling that empowers over 9,000 engineers with their productivity needs and enables them to write high quality, performant and secure code.
The Software Composition Analysis and Security (SCAnS) team in DevX plays a foundational role in securing Bloomberg’s software supply chain (SSC) by enabling engineers to use open source and third party software safely, in an operationally resilient manner. Our products integrate with build and analysis systems to ensure software component metadata (as SBOMs) is available throughout the SSC to build a software inventory, affording license and vulnerability identification firm-wide. We control the ingress of components to prevent malware from entering the network, which provides us a unique opportunity to help build this inventory.
Our team is responsible for:
- Providing SBOM tooling and helping integrate it into our supply chain
- Working across ecosystems to adjust our tooling to produce the best quality results
- Controlling and tracking the ingress of software components into the firm’s network
- Solving the firm’s operational resiliency needs for software ingress and component analysis
We are looking for a Senior Software Engineer to drive these projects in the SCAnS team.
As an engineer in this growing team, you will be at the heart of Bloomberg’s efforts to secure our software supply chain. This domain is extremely important for the firm’s security and operational resilience posture, and your work will be equally impactful and leveraged by all engineering teams.
With upcoming regulations around Operational Resilience such as DORA, Software Supply Chain security is a hot topic in the industry and a very dynamic space to be involved in. Our team leverages open-source software (e.g. Syft), and also influences the wider industry on standards for SBOMs and SSC. We also have home-grown solutions for specific problems (e.g. the domain of Ingress), providing a broad mix of technologies and approaches.
We will trust you to:
- Collaborate across multiple teams to perform cross-cutting work
- Work with users to understand their needs
- Develop and deploy scalable solutions to meeting our supply chain needs
- Identify risks with our supply chain end-to-end
You’ll need to have:
- Experience in Python or Go
- Knowledge of the software development lifecycle
- A passion for improving the firm’s security posture
- A drive to partner and collaborate with users and team members alike
We’d love to see:
- Experience making upstream contributions
- A history of making changes that involve multiple teams
- Knowledge of software supply chains, SBOMs, and how they are used
- An awareness of vulnerability, malware and licensing challenges in third party software
Bloomberg is an equal opportunity employer and we value diversity at our company. We do not discriminate on the basis of age, ancestry, color, gender identity or expression, genetic predisposition or carrier status, marital status, national or ethnic origin, race, religion or belief, sex, sexual orientation, sexual and other reproductive health decisions, parental or caring status, physical or mental disability, pregnancy or parental leave, protected veteran status, status as a victim of domestic violence, or any other classification protected by applicable law.
Bloomberg is a disability inclusive employer. Please let us know if you require any reasonable adjustments to be made for the recruitment process. If you would prefer to discuss this confidentially, please email amer_recruit@bloomberg.net.
Senior Software Engineer - DevX SCAnS London, GBR Posted today employer: Bloomberg L.P.
Contact Detail:
Bloomberg L.P. Recruiting Team
StudySmarter Expert Advice 🤫
We think this is how you could land Senior Software Engineer - DevX SCAnS London, GBR Posted today
✨Tip Number 1
Familiarise yourself with the latest trends in software supply chain security. Understanding regulations like DORA and how they impact the industry will show your commitment to the role and help you engage in meaningful conversations during interviews.
✨Tip Number 2
Network with professionals in the field of software security and supply chains. Attend relevant meetups or webinars, and connect with current Bloomberg employees on platforms like LinkedIn to gain insights into the company culture and expectations.
✨Tip Number 3
Brush up on your Python or Go skills, as these are essential for the role. Consider working on personal projects or contributing to open-source initiatives that demonstrate your coding abilities and understanding of software development lifecycles.
✨Tip Number 4
Prepare to discuss your experience with cross-team collaboration. Think of specific examples where you've successfully worked with multiple teams to solve complex problems, as this is a key aspect of the role at Bloomberg.
We think you need these skills to ace Senior Software Engineer - DevX SCAnS London, GBR Posted today
Some tips for your application 🫡
Understand the Role: Read the job description thoroughly to grasp the responsibilities and requirements of the Senior Software Engineer position. Tailor your application to highlight relevant experiences and skills that align with the role.
Highlight Relevant Experience: Emphasise your experience in Python or Go, as well as your knowledge of the software development lifecycle. Provide specific examples of projects where you improved security posture or collaborated across teams.
Showcase Your Passion: Convey your enthusiasm for software supply chain security and operational resilience. Mention any relevant contributions to open-source projects or initiatives that demonstrate your commitment to improving security practices.
Craft a Strong Cover Letter: Write a compelling cover letter that connects your background to Bloomberg's mission. Discuss how your skills can contribute to the SCAnS team's goals and express your eagerness to be part of their innovative work.
How to prepare for a job interview at Bloomberg L.P.
✨Showcase Your Technical Skills
Be prepared to discuss your experience with Python or Go in detail. Highlight specific projects where you've used these languages, especially in relation to software supply chains or security.
✨Understand the Software Development Lifecycle
Demonstrate your knowledge of the software development lifecycle and how it relates to operational resilience. Be ready to discuss how you have contributed to improving processes in previous roles.
✨Emphasise Collaboration
Since the role involves working across multiple teams, share examples of how you've successfully collaborated with others in past projects. This could include cross-team initiatives or contributions to open-source projects.
✨Discuss Security Awareness
Talk about your understanding of vulnerabilities, malware, and licensing challenges in third-party software. Providing real-world examples of how you've addressed these issues will show your passion for improving security.